我们该怎么做?
我正在尝试编写普通的JavaScript,我的编辑器告诉我在有类型注释时没有语法错误,这是意外的。
eslintrc:
module.exports = {
parser: 'babel-eslint',
}
这是babel-eslint的事吗?
Sidenote:现在要实现此目的,我回到没有babel-eslint的纯ESLint上,这不太方便,因为我必须编写没有实验性功能的代码,但是可以完成工作(在类型注释上显示错误)
非babel-eslint配置如下:
module.exports = {
parserOptions: {
sourceType: 'module',
ecmaVersion: 2018,
ecmaFeatures: {
jsx: true,
impliedStrict: true,
},
},
}